About Rich Dill, Phd, Ts/Sci, Cissp
Twenty-year Air Force cyber career spanning leadership, operations, and research and development. Experience in full-spectrum cyber warfare – planning, offensive, defensive, and mission support, and applying machine learning (ML) techniques to solve hard problems. Eight years of experience as a researcher and Principal Investigator (PI) for a portfolio of grants in cyber security, machine learning for low-powered devices, sensor fusion to characterize/profile the environment, and decision-making in wargaming. Highly adept at bridging the gap between theory and application. Team player and eager to tackle hard problems.
